Output 661bd636996b19d548ee9219d644cb824bb5f87018d117d68c8ab8b23d0a07b9:21

value
10365089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ef244db142efc89e1d20e5dacc4eb02619d214ee OP_EQUAL
address
MVhdDgrzBuj3kvJkgcc2VuWAEN8hQUZVDG
transaction
661bd636996b19d548ee9219d644cb824bb5f87018d117d68c8ab8b23d0a07b9
spent
true